Escape to the charming Countryside Inn, where a warm welcome awaits. Close to Princeton Golf Club and China Ridge Trails, enjoy free in-room WiFi, barbecue grills for outdoor gatherings and helpful staff on hand.

About this property

Countryside Inn

Countryside Inn is a great choice for a stay in Princeton. Freebies like WiFi and self parking are added perks, and guests looking to stay active can check out the nearby hiking/biking trails. Fellow travelers say great things about the helpful staff.
